Generally, if you have thick, frizzy hair then you need a moisturizing shampoo and conditioner. In addition, if you have thin hair, then the best product to buy is a volumizing shampoo and conditioner. Furthermore, if your hair is curly then use a sulfate-free shampoo and conditioner. However, in late 18th Century UK, white hair powder started being taxed. Aristocrats such as the Duke of Bedford retaliated by cropping their hair short in protest. Across the channel, however, Louis XIII of France sought to conceal his premature baldness and the wig began to appear. Men’s long hairstyles at least worn as wigs surged in popularity across Europe especially through his son and successor, Louis XIV. For long, rectangular faces, steer clear of styles in which the hair is brushed up and away from the forehead. Particularly if this results in additional height on top. All this will do is accentuate the length of the face and make the forehead appear more pronounced.

Keep in mind that heat will damage your hair, so look for a blow dryer made with a ceramic heating element—we're partial to the BaBylissPRO Cermix Extreme Hair Dry ($75). The internal ceramic unit smoothes down the hair cuticle rather than blowing it open and actually cuts down on drying time.
